Bulova Watchmaking School Co-founder Stanley Simon Dies at 93
The New York Times is reporting that Stanley Simon, who was instrumental in bringing the Bulova Watchmaking School into being, has passed away in Manhattan. He was 93. The School, founded in 1945, became a model for industry-lead rehabilitation of disabled veterans. First conceived as World War II drew to an end, the school trained thousands of veterans in the watchmaker’s art. The school was founded by company president Arde Bulova, who wanted to repay the service of returning veterans. He named it for his father Joseph, who founded the Bulova Watch Company in New York in 1875.As Bulova’s industrial relations director, Stanley Simon played a central role in the school’s development. He oversaw construction of the school’s building, where ramps, automatic doors, and extra-wide elevators accommodated wheelchairs.
